| Summary | Annotation The third edition of Richard Lindberg's best-selling Total White Sox - the definitive, most comprehensive history of the beloved South Side ballclub ever published in one volume - moves the story forward from the champagne-soaked celebrations following the 2005 World Series championship through the 2010 season. Featuring dozens of new and rarely seen photographs, more than 200 player biographies, year-by-year coverage from 1900 through 2010, front office profiles, complete postseason wrap-ups, great moments in team history, a richly detailed statistics section, a treasure trove of little-known facts, oddities, and trivia, plus behind-the-scenes stories of Ozzie Guillen, Kenny Williams, and the entire South Side clan, Total White Sox embraces the colorful and occasionally outrageous history of President Barack Obama's favorite ballclub. |
